We’re looking for a highly motivated Technical Support Specialist to join a leading medical technology company within the Cardiac Rhythm Management (CRM) space. This field-based role offers the opportunity to work hands-on with life-saving cardiac devices, supporting clinical teams across Northern Ireland.

You’ll provide technical expertise during implantations and follow-ups, train healthcare professionals, and act as a key clinical contact across a wide territory. It’s a high-impact role that combines technical knowledge, clinical presence, and customer-facing service.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ide on-site and remote technical support during device implantations and patient follow-up
  • Assist with clinical trials, troubleshooting, product configurations, and upgrades
  • Deliver product training to internal teams and healthcare professionals
  • Build strong relationships with cardiologists, EPs, and clinical teams at key accounts
  • Coordinate with sales and product teams to support business development
  • Support regional and national events, congresses, and training sessions
  • Maintain compliance with reporting processes, documentation, and quality standards

Who We’re Looking For:

  • Background in Cardiac Physiology, Biomedical Engineering, or related discipline
  • At least 3 years of experience working in CRM, ideally in pacemaker/ICD/CRT clinics or field roles
  • Strong knowledge of cardiac anatomy, physiology, and device therapy
  • Confident communicator — able to clearly explain complex technical issues to clinical teams
  • Comfortable with high travel demands (50–70%) and occasional on-call support
  • A proactive, solutions-oriented mindset and excellent organisational skills
  • Full UK driver’s license required

Preferred (But Not Essential):

  • IBHRE or HRUK certification in cardiac devices or EP
  • Experience supporting implantations or working in a Cardiac Cath Lab
  • Familiarity with device interrogation, troubleshooting, and data interpretation
